Dancing With the Stars” was filled with a few unhappy contestants on Tuesday’s “Latin Night.”

While Peta Murgatroyd and actor Barry Williams struggled in the first week and earned a score of 16, the pair worked hard on this week’s Cha-Cha to “Oye Como Va” by Tito Puente and were pretty shcoked to earn a 5 from judge Carrie Ann Inaba. Following the score, the ABC broadcast went silent as Murgatroyd appeared to respond with “bulls–t,” which was bleeped out of the live telecast.

Still, the duo didn’t land in the bottom two. Instead, it was the most controversial dancer of the season, Adrian Peterson, who landed in the bottom alongside Jamie Lynn Spears. Peterson’s package this week seemingly tried to appeal to the audience, showing his life at home as he introduced partner Britt Stewart to his newborn baby. Peterson and Stewart received a score of 15 for their routine, three points lower than the first week.

Ariana Madix and Pasha Pashkov also earned one point lower than week one, with a score of a 20, but the “Vanderpump Rules” alum remained positive as she admitted the samba is much more difficult than the tango. On the other side of the spectrum, Alyson Hannigan and Sasha Farber, who earned a score of 13 during the premiere, scored a 19 for their sensual tango, showing massive improvement.

Mauricio Umansky and Emma Slater, who landed in the bottom two during the first week, had another rough week, as he made multiple mistakes during the routine and earned a score of 12. Still, he was safe.

In the end, Spears was sent home in what judge Derek Hough called a “shocker,” especially given that multiple teams earned lower scores.
